When calculating the cost of a long-distance move, several variables come into play. The most significant factor is the total weight or volume of your belongings, as this determines the space required in the truck. Distance is equally important, as fuel and driver hours add up quickly. You should also consider the complexity of the move, such as stairs, long carry distances from your door to the truck, or the need for specialty packing. Local moving services in Peoria focus on shorter distances, typically within the same metropolitan area. Long-distance movers handle relocations across state lines. They possess specialized knowledge of interstate regulations and logistics. For any move outside of Illinois, you’ll need a long-distance specialist. They ensure a smooth transition to your new state.
